NVD · unedited
go-git is a highly extensible git implementation library written in pure Go. A denial of service (DoS) vulnerability was discovered in go-git versions prior to v5.13. This vulnerability allows an attacker to perform denial of service attacks by providing specially crafted responses from a Git server which triggers resource exhaustion in go-git clients. Users running versions of go-git from v4 and above are recommended to upgrade to v5.13 in order to mitigate this vulnerability.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Locate go-git dependency in your project
    Search for 'go-git' in your go.mod file, vendor/modules.txt, or dependency lock files
    Affected if go-git is present as a dependency
  2. Identify the installed version of go-git
    Run 'go list -m all | grep go-git' or check the version line in your go.mod file (format: module version, e.g., github.com/go-git/go-git/v5 v5.12.0)
    Affected if The version shown is earlier than v5.13.0 (such as v5.12.0, v5.11.0, etc.)
  3. Verify if your application uses go-git for remote operations
    Search source code for calls to 'Clone', 'Fetch', 'Pull', or 'NewRemote' which connect to Git servers
    Affected if Your code makes remote Git connections using go-git
  4. Check for untrusted Git server connections
    Review whether go-git connects to user-controlled or unverified Git servers (e.g., user-provided URLs, external APIs)
    Affected if Your application connects to Git servers you do not fully control or trust

You are affected if go-git version earlier than v5.13.0 is installed AND your application uses it to connect to remote Git servers, especially untrusted ones.

Recommended fix High confidence

v5.13.0

  1. Run 'go get github.com/go-git/go-git/[email protected]' to upgrade to the fixed version
  2. Run 'go mod tidy' to update go.mod and go.sum files
  3. Verify the upgrade by checking the version: go list -m github.com/go-git/go-git/v5
  4. Rebuild and test your application to ensure compatibility with the new version
